Featured picture for City of Loris reports water outage affecting Market Street and Franklin Street

City of Loris reports water outage affecting Market Street and Franklin Street

There is a water outage in Loris, according to the City of Loris. Starting at 10:30 today, a water break is in effect. This is affecting Market Street and Franklin Street. The City of Loris does not have a time frame for when repairs will be completed.
